Understanding Sam Altman’s Journey

Sam Altman, the CEO of OpenAI, has transformed from a lesser-known figure in tech to a global celebrity due to the success of ChatGPT. His life is now a mix of personal milestones and professional triumphs, all set against the serene backdrop of his Napa Valley farm. Altman is not just leading a tech revolution; he is also navigating the complexities of fame, family, and the ethical implications of artificial intelligence. With a valuation exceeding $250 billion, OpenAI is at the forefront of the AI race, pushing towards artificial general intelligence, which could redefine human capability.

Key Highlights

  • Altman has faced significant challenges, including being fired and reinstated at OpenAI, which showcased his leadership resilience.
  • His journey includes a partnership with SoftBank to raise funds for AI infrastructure, indicating his ambitions for OpenAI’s growth.
  • The release of OpenAI’s new model, o3, has sparked discussions about the future of AI art and the need for new business models to compensate artists.
  • Altman acknowledges the rapid pace of AI development and the potential risks, advocating for responsible technology use and collective decision-making.
